专栏首页SAP Technical关于数据库的NULL
原创

关于数据库的NULL

关于数据库的NULL,EQ sapce 不等效于 IS NULL。

通过SAP创建的表,如果是初次创建,所有的列都会存在一个初始值(MANDT为'000',普通CHAR类型为' ',日期类型为'00000000',数值类型为0。。等等),即Field的NOT NULL为'X',不允许空值。当这个表有了一部分数据后,又更改这个表,添加了一些字段,那么这些新加的字段如果不勾上“Initial Value”就有可能有空值了,也就是NULL值,这样就给SELECT带来很大麻烦。

解决的办法就是勾中“Initial Value”,这样就能够保证字段有初始值了。

原创声明,本文系作者授权云+社区发表,未经许可,不得转载。

如有侵权,请联系 yunjia_community@tencent.com 删除。

我来说两句

0 条评论
登录 后参与评论

相关文章

  • 【SAP HANA系列】SAP HANA XS的JavaScript API详解

    SAP HANA扩展应用程序服务(SAP HANA XS)提供了一组服务器端JavaScript应用程序编程接口(API),可配置应用程序与SAP HANA进行...

    matinal
  • SAP Fiori的ABAP编程模型-BOPF 简介

    BOPF (业务对象处理框架)是用于BO(业务对象)的框架。该框架为整个BO生命周期提供工具和服务。

    matinal
  • SAP FICO新总账功能解析大全

      新总账的功能和新增功能并不止下面这些,只是其他的功能用的很少,或者根本就没怎么得到应用,所以我也就不进行研究和学习。毕竟,这是一个讲究实用的年代,没有用武之...

    matinal
  • 这些Java 代码必须要说一说优化细节!

    代码 优化 ,一个很重要的课题。可能有些人觉得没用,一些细小的地方有什么好修改的,改与不改对于代码的运行效率有什么影响呢?这个问题我是这么考虑的,就像大海里面的...

    用户5224393
  • 你只是想学好linux而已

    这段时间收到了很多学员关于学习上的疑惑,在这些疑惑当中有80%是关于学习方向的疑惑。比如: 1. 我想学好Linux ,是不是应该先学好英语?...

    互联网老辛
  • ActiveReports 报表应用教程 (4)---分栏报表

    在葡萄城ActiveReports报表中可以实现分栏报表布局样式,可以设置横向分栏、纵向分栏,同时进行分栏和分组设置,统计分栏分组的小计、合计等。在商业报表系统...

    葡萄城控件
  • Go进阶笔记关于Error

    其实很多时候是使用的姿势不对,或者说,对于error的用法没有完全理解,这里整理一下关于Go中的error 。

    后场技术
  • React生命周期简单分析

    1.React16.3的发布带来了一些新的特性, 除了新的ContextAPI之外, 还对生命周期做了部分修改, 为了支持未来的异步渲染特性, 一下生命周期将被...

    IMWeb前端团队
  • 哺乳动物胚胎发生过程的分子记录

    当你的才华还撑不起你的野心时,请潜下心来,脚踏实地,跟着我们慢慢进步。不知不觉在单细胞转录组领域做知识分析也快两年了,通过文献速递这个栏目很幸运聚集了一些小伙伴...

    生信技能树jimmy
  • 2017年的Linux内核防护依然脆弱

    “Linux 内核 “社区” 对待安全的优先级并不高,虽然经历了 2000 年代的多次大规模漏洞利用事件但并没有让 Linus Torvalds 本人改变 “A...

    Debian中国

扫码关注云+社区

领取腾讯云代金券